summaryrefslogtreecommitdiff
path: root/lib
diff options
context:
space:
mode:
Diffstat (limited to 'lib')
-rw-r--r--lib/btrfs/btrfsitem/item_dir.go2
-rw-r--r--lib/btrfs/btrfssum/csum.go6
-rw-r--r--lib/btrfsprogs/btrfsinspect/print_tree.go2
3 files changed, 5 insertions, 5 deletions
diff --git a/lib/btrfs/btrfsitem/item_dir.go b/lib/btrfs/btrfsitem/item_dir.go
index 836c477..b3e33f4 100644
--- a/lib/btrfs/btrfsitem/item_dir.go
+++ b/lib/btrfs/btrfsitem/item_dir.go
@@ -30,7 +30,7 @@ type DirEntry struct { // DIR_ITEM=84 DIR_INDEX=96 XATTR_ITEM=24
NameLen uint16 `bin:"off=0x1b, siz=2"` // [ignored-when-writing]
Type FileType `bin:"off=0x1d, siz=1"`
binstruct.End `bin:"off=0x1e"`
- Data []byte `bin:"-"`
+ Data []byte `bin:"-"` // xattr value (only for XATTR_ITEM)
Name []byte `bin:"-"`
}
diff --git a/lib/btrfs/btrfssum/csum.go b/lib/btrfs/btrfssum/csum.go
index c7c1f37..770f6ea 100644
--- a/lib/btrfs/btrfssum/csum.go
+++ b/lib/btrfs/btrfssum/csum.go
@@ -91,11 +91,11 @@ func (typ CSumType) Sum(data []byte) (CSum, error) {
binary.LittleEndian.PutUint32(ret[:], crc)
return ret, nil
case TYPE_XXHASH:
- panic("not implemented")
+ panic("TODO: XXHASH not yet implemented")
case TYPE_SHA256:
- panic("not implemented")
+ panic("TODO: SHA256 not yet implemented")
case TYPE_BLAKE2:
- panic("not implemented")
+ panic("TODO: BLAKE2 not yet implemented")
default:
return CSum{}, fmt.Errorf("unknown checksum type: %v", typ)
}
diff --git a/lib/btrfsprogs/btrfsinspect/print_tree.go b/lib/btrfsprogs/btrfsinspect/print_tree.go
index 2ede80f..6c31350 100644
--- a/lib/btrfsprogs/btrfsinspect/print_tree.go
+++ b/lib/btrfsprogs/btrfsinspect/print_tree.go
@@ -427,7 +427,7 @@ func fmtKey(key btrfsprim.Key) string {
textui.Fprintf(&out, "key (%v %v", key.ObjectID.Format(key.ItemType), key.ItemType)
switch key.ItemType {
case btrfsitem.QGROUP_RELATION_KEY: //TODO, btrfsitem.QGROUP_INFO_KEY, btrfsitem.QGROUP_LIMIT_KEY:
- panic("not implemented")
+ panic("TODO: printing qgroup items not yet implemented")
case btrfsitem.UUID_SUBVOL_KEY, btrfsitem.UUID_RECEIVED_SUBVOL_KEY:
textui.Fprintf(&out, " %#08x)", key.Offset)
case btrfsitem.ROOT_ITEM_KEY: